Before jumping into fixes, diagnose the source. Low pressure may stem from outdated pipes, mineral buildup, neighborhood supply issues, or faulty pressure regulators. Check if the problem is isolated to one fixture or affects the entire home. Turning off all faucets and monitoring pressure with a gauge can reveal hidden issues like clogged aerators or high water usage spikes.

A common yet effective solution is to clean aerators and showerheads, which often collect mineral deposits that restrict water flow. Soaking these parts in vinegar or using a small brush can restore flow. For internal clogs, running hot water through pipes periodically helps dislodge buildup. Regular maintenance prevents gradual pressure loss and extends the lifespan of your plumbing system.

If fixture cleaning doesn’t work, consider upgrading components like pressure-regulating valves or replacing corroded pipes. Older galvanized steel pipes corrosion and scale buildup significantly reduce pressure. Switching to modern PEX or copper piping improves flow and durability. Consulting a licensed plumber ensures safe upgrades that match your home’s specific needs and local water pressure standards.

Ensure your home’s connection to the municipal supply isn’t restricted by external factors like water main breaks or peak usage times. Installing a dedicated water pressure booster pump can dramatically increase flow, especially in older homes. When DIY fixes fail or pressure remains inconsistent, a professional inspection uncovers hidden problems and provides tailored solutions for lasting improvement.
